Cooling System Care: Preparing for Hot Summers

Air conditioners work hardest when the heat is at its peak, and without proper care, they may fail when needed most. Common problems include reduced airflow, refrigerant leaks, or frozen evaporator coils. 

Preparing for summer means scheduling maintenance before the hottest days arrive. A technician can check refrigerant levels, clean coils, and test the system to ensure everything runs at peak performance. Taking preventive measures saves money on repairs, extends the life of the unit, and ensures that the home stays comfortable even during prolonged heat waves.

Air Filters: Small Part, Big Impact

Although air filters seem like a minor part of an HVAC system, they play a critical role in both efficiency and indoor air quality.

Filters trap dust, pollen, and other particles, keeping the air clean and preventing buildup inside the system. Filters often get clogged.

As a result airflow is restricted which forces the system to work harder. This not only raises energy bills but also increases the risk of mechanical strain.

Replacing or cleaning filters regularly is one of the simplest ways to keep the system in good condition. Most households benefit from changing filters every one to three months, depending on usage and the presence of pets or allergies. 

Thermostat Upgrades and Settings

The thermostat is the control center of the HVAC system, and upgrading to a programmable or smart thermostat can bring noticeable benefits. These devices allow homeowners to set schedules that match daily routines, which reduces unnecessary heating and cooling when no one is home. Smart thermostats also provide detailed energy reports and can make automatic adjustments for greater efficiency.

Seasonal thermostat settings are another way to manage comfort and cost. Keeping the temperature slightly cooler in winter and warmer in summer reduces strain on the system while still maintaining a pleasant indoor environment. Placement of the thermostat also matters; if it is installed near windows or heat sources, it may misread the temperature, causing the system to run longer than needed. 

Ductwork Inspections and Cleaning

The ductwork in an HVAC system acts as the pathway for conditioned air, and any problems with it can affect the entire system. Leaky ducts allow air to escape, which makes the system work harder to maintain the desired temperature. Dirty ducts, on the other hand, can spread dust and allergens throughout the home, reducing air quality and increasing health concerns.

A professional inspection helps identify leaks, blockages, or buildup that may be reducing efficiency. While small leaks can sometimes be sealed with specialized tape, larger problems require professional repair. Cleaning ducts every few years also helps prevent dust accumulation and improves the quality of air in the home. 

Energy-Saving Practices for HVAC Systems

While professional maintenance is important, everyday habits also have a big influence on HVAC performance.

Small adjustments in how a home is managed can reduce the strain on the system and cut energy costs.

For example, ceiling fans help circulate air, making rooms feel cooler in summer and warmer in winter without overworking the system.

Closing blinds during hot afternoons keeps excess heat out, while opening them in the winter can bring in natural warmth.

Proper insulation also plays a key role in HVAC efficiency. Sealing gaps around windows, doors, and attic spaces prevents air leaks that force the system to work harder.

Indoor Air Quality Enhancements

Comfort is about more than just temperature. Air quality is equally important, and HVAC systems play a big role in maintaining it.

Dry winter air can cause discomfort, while excessive summer humidity can make rooms feel warmer than they are.

Adding a humidifier or dehumidifier creates balance, reducing stress on the HVAC system while improving overall comfort.

Air purifiers are another useful addition, particularly for households with allergies or respiratory concerns.

By capturing fine particles like pollen, dust, and pet dander, they improve indoor air and help the HVAC system stay cleaner for longer.

These enhancements create a healthier living environment while ensuring the system operates under better conditions.

Knowing When Repairs Aren’t Enough

Even with consistent care, HVAC systems don’t last forever. Over time, efficiency drops and repair costs begin to climb. Recognizing the point at which repairs are no longer worthwhile can save money in the long run. Warning signs include frequent breakdowns, uneven heating or cooling, and rising utility bills despite maintenance.

When repair costs begin to approach the price of a new system, replacement becomes the smarter choice. Modern HVAC systems are designed with advanced technology that delivers better efficiency and performance. While the initial cost of replacement can be significant, the long-term savings on energy bills and reduced repair expenses often outweigh the investment.
